Breastfeeding Basics: Making Breastfeeding Easier

Samis Education Center | 1200 Children's Ave, Oklahoma City, OK

1-day Training Course $ FREE (via a contract with the Oklahoma State Department of Health) 7.5 CEUs Agenda This class teaches health care staff current information and skills to support breastfeeding mothers and their children, particularly during the prenatal and early postpartum periods. PSI-OK Maternal Mental Health Walk

The PSI-OK is hosting a maternal mental health walk to raise money for their social support program, which will help Oklahoman moms pay for services they otherwise can't afford. Webinar: Learn about the New 2020 Joint Commission Maternal Safety Standards

The Joint Commission has identified the highest impact for improving maternal morbidity and mortality is in the prevention, early recognition, and timely treatment of both maternal hemorrhage and severe hypertensive/preeclampsia.
